The Foundations of Reliable Online Gambling Platforms
At the heart of a reputable online casino lies a commitment to safeguarding players’ identities and ensuring fair play. Effective identity verification is critical for preventing fraud, money laundering, and underage gambling. Regulatory bodies across jurisdictions, including the UK Gambling Commission, impose strict standards for Know Your Customer (KYC) procedures, which hinge heavily on account verification processes.
From Registration to Play: The Evolving Role of Verification
Traditionally, players might have completed brief forms during registration; however, the modern approach integrates multi-layered verification steps. These procedures include document checks, biometric authentication, and sometimes live video verification—culminating in a transparent, secure onboarding process.
Strategic Insights into the Verification Lifecycle
Effective verification involves several stages, backed by data-driven techniques:
- Identity validation: Confirming government-issued ID authenticity (passport, driver’s licence).
- Address verification: Linking physical residence to official documents.
- Enhanced due diligence: For high-value accounts, additional scrutiny through third-party databases or biometric verification.
Industry leaders continuously invest in technologies such as AI-powered identity checks, which can authenticate documents within seconds while reducing false positives. As an example, a recent report indicated that AI algorithms achieve over 98% accuracy in document verification, significantly streamlining user onboarding while maintaining compliance.

Future Outlook: Innovations Shaping Verification Procedures
| Emerging Technology | Potential Impact | Industry Adoption |
|---|---|---|
| Biometric Authentication | Real-time identity confirmation via facial or fingerprint recognition | Increasingly adopted by top-tier operators for seamless user experience |
| Blockchain-Based Verification | Decentralised ID verification ensuring data integrity | Early adoption; promising for transparency and security |
| AI & Machine Learning | Continuous fraud detection and monitoring | Industry standard for proactive compliance and risk mitigation |
